Q14 (IAS/2026) History & Culture › Art & Architecture Official Key

Which of the following temples has/have a Nagara-style shikhara?
1. Malegitti Shivalaya, Badami
2. Huchimalligudi Temple, Aihole
3. Dashavatara Temple, Deogarh
4. Virupaksha Temple, Pattadakal
Select the answer using the code given below:

Result
Your answer:  ·  Correct: B

Explanation

The correct answer is 2 and 3.

  • Malegitti Shivalaya, Badami: This is an early Chalukyan rock-cut and structural temple built in the Dravida style, featuring an octagonal dome-like shikhara.
  • Huchimalligudi Temple, Aihole: This temple is a prominent example of early Chalukyan architecture that features a curvilinear Rekha-Nagara (Nagara-style) shikhara.
  • Dashavatara Temple, Deogarh: Built during the Gupta period, it is one of the earliest known Panchayatana temples in North India and marks the early development of the Nagara style of temple architecture with a prominent shikhara.
  • Virupaksha Temple, Pattadakal: Built by Queen Lokamahadevi to commemorate her husband Vikramaditya II's victory over the Pallavas, this temple is a classic example of the Dravida style with a stepped pyramidal vimana.

Therefore, only the Huchimalligudi and Dashavatara temples have Nagara-style shikharas.
